{ "id": "0810.0734", "version": "v2", "published": "2008-10-03T23:24:04.000Z", "updated": "2019-08-18T14:54:25.000Z", "title": "Unstable classes of metric structures", "authors": [ "Saharon Shelah", "Alexander Usvyatsov" ], "categories": [ "math.LO", "math.FA" ], "abstract": "We prove a strong non-structure theorem for a class of metric structures with an unstable pair of formulae. As a consequence, we show that weak categoricity (that is, categoricity up to isomorphisms and not isometries) implies several versions of stability. This is the first step in the direction of the investigation of weak categoricity and weak stability of metric classes.", "revisions": [ { "version": "v1", "updated": "2008-10-03T23:24:04.000Z", "abstract": "We prove a strong nonstructure theorem for a class of metric structures with an unstable formula.
